Voluntary recall of 125cc Hybrid scooter models by Yamaha
Scooters manufactured between January 1, 2022, to January 4, 2024, are part of the recall activity. Customers to get replacement parts free of cost at their nearest Yamaha Service centers.

Staying committed to the highest quality and safety standards of products, India Yamaha Motor Pvt. Ltd. (IYM), has announced a voluntary recall of around 300,000 units of 125cc scooters manufactured between January 1, 2022 to January 4, 2024, with immediate effect. Customer safety remains the utmost priority for Yamaha and in line with this promise, this recall is aimed at resolving an issue with the brake lever function in select units of the Ray ZR 125 Fi Hybrid and Fascino 125 Fi Hybrid scooter models (Jan 2022 onward models). The replacement part is being provided to the concerned customer free of charge. To verify the eligibility for the recall, customers should visit the Service section of India Yamaha Motor website (https://www.yamaha-motor-india.com/), navigate to the ‘SC 125 Voluntary Recall’ and enter their Chassis No. details to know the next steps. In addition, customers can visit their nearest Yamaha service center and/or reach out to India Yamaha Motor at the toll-free number – 1800-420-1600 for further assistance.
